At least twenty people were killed following an early Monday attack by armed gangs in a commune located in the hills east of Port-au-Prince, Haiti. Some local media outlets have reported the death toll could be as high as forty.
The violent assault targeted a peaceful agricultural community within the jurisdiction of Kenscoff, according to local Mayor Jean Massillon. The severity of the massacre has prompted security forces to go on high alert in response to the ongoing violence perpetrated by the powerful gang coalition.
